Window and Door Repair: Essential Guide for Homeowners
Windows and doors are integral parts of any home, contributing to its visual appeal, energy performance, and security. In time, wear and tear can lead to the requirement for repairs to preserve functionality and appearance. This short article supplies a thorough look at window and door repair, dealing with typical issues, repair strategies, and maintenance tips.
Typical Issues with Windows and DoorsWindows
Drafts
Brought on by degrading seals or used weather condition stripping.Causes energy ineffectiveness and increased heating or cooling costs.
Cracks or Breaks in Glass
Can result from effect, severe temperature levels, or making flaws.Compromises safety and energy performance.
Difficulty Opening or Closing
May emerge from misalignment, rust, or debris build-up in tracks.
Condensation Between Glass Panes
Suggests seal failure in double or triple-pane windows.Lead to reduced insulation and presence.Doors
Wood Rot
Typical in wood Doors Repair, especially at the base.Caused by water direct exposure, resulting in structural integrity problems.
Misalignment
Can take place due to settling of the home or harmed hinges.Results in difficulty closing and potential security threats.
Damaged Weather Stripping
Degrades in time, allowing air leakages.Decreases energy performance and comfort levels inside.
Broken Locks or Handles

While many window and door repairs can be dealt with as DIY tasks, some circumstances might need professional knowledge. Property owners should think about the complexity of the repair, their comfort level with tools, and the time they have available. For significant concerns, such as comprehensive water damage or broken glass replacement, hiring a professional is recommended.

To extend the lifespan of doors and windows and lessen repair needs, property owners need to embrace routine maintenance practices:
Regular Inspections
Inspect for signs of wear, water damage, and drafts a minimum of twice a year.
Clean Tracks and Frames
Eliminate particles from window tracks and door frames to guarantee smooth operation.
Change Weather Stripping
Change worn weather removing every couple of years to maintain energy performance.
Paint and Seal
Keep wooden doors painted and sealed to avoid wetness penetration.
Oil Hinges and Mechanisms

Check for debris in the tracks or hinges and guarantee that the frame is not warped. If you can not determine the concern, consider consulting an expert.
How can I inform if my door requires repair or replacement?
Search for substantial damage, such as wood rot or comprehensive warping. If repairs would cost more than half the cost of a replacement, it might be more affordable to change the door.
What is the typical cost of window repairs?
Costs differ widely based on the kind of repair and materials needed, but general window repairs normally range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 600.
How often should I perform maintenance look at my windows and doors?
It is suggested to check them at least two times a year, ideally throughout seasonal modifications.
Can I repair fogged windows myself?
Small cases of fogging might be attended to with repair sets, however for substantial seal failures, professional replacement of the window system is frequently the very best option.
